  3. A Uniform Theory of Conditionals.William B. Starr - 2014 - Journal of Philosophical Logic 43 (6):1019-1064.
    A uniform theory of conditionals is one which compositionally captures the behavior of both indicative and subjunctive conditionals without positing ambiguities. This paper raises new problems for the closest thing to a uniform analysis in the literature (Stalnaker, Philosophia, 5, 269–286 (1975)) and develops a new theory which solves them. I also show that this new analysis provides an improved treatment of three phenomena (the import-export equivalence, reverse Sobel-sequences and disjunctive antecedents).   4. The Uniformity Principle vs. the Disuniformity Principle.Seungbae Park - 2017 - Acta Analytica 32 (2):213-222.
    The pessimistic induction is built upon the uniformity principle that the future resembles the past. In daily scientific activities, however, scientists sometimes rely on what I call the disuniformity principle that the future differs from the past. They do not give up their research projects despite the repeated failures. They believe that they will succeed although they failed repeatedly, and as a result they achieve what they intended to achieve.     Uniformity motivated.Cameron Domenico Kirk-Giannini - 2018 - Linguistics and Philosophy 41 (6):665-684.
    Can rational communication proceed when interlocutors are uncertain which contents utterances contribute to discourse? An influential negative answer to this question is embodied in the Stalnakerian principle of uniformity, which requires speakers to produce only utterances that express the same content in every possibility treated as live for the purposes of the conversation. The principle of uniformity enjoys considerable intuitive plausibility and, moreover, seems to follow from platitudes about assertion; nevertheless, it has recently proven controversial.   14. A Uniform Logic of Information Dynamics.Wesley H. Holliday, Tomohiro Hoshi & Thomas F. Icard - 2012 - In Thomas Bolander, Torben Braüner, Silvio Ghilardi & Lawrence Moss (eds.), Advances in Modal Logic 9. College Publications. pp. 348-367.
    Unlike standard modal logics, many dynamic epistemic logics are not closed under uniform substitution. A distinction therefore arises between the logic and its substitution core, the set of formulas all of whose substitution instances are valid. The classic example of a non-uniform dynamic epistemic logic is Public Announcement Logic (PAL), and a well-known open problem is to axiomatize the substitution core of PAL.   22. The uniformity of nature.Wesley C. Salmon - 1953 - Philosophy and Phenomenological Research 14 (1):39-48.
    The principle of uniformity of nature has sometimes been invoked for the purpose of justifying induction. This principle cannot be established "a priori", And in the absence of a justification of induction, It cannot be established "a posteriori". There is no justification for assuming it as a postulate of science. Use of such a principle is, However, Neither sufficient nor necessary for a justification of induction.     On uniform weak König's lemma.Ulrich Kohlenbach - 2002 - Annals of Pure and Applied Logic 114 (1-3):103-116.
    The so-called weak König's lemma WKL asserts the existence of an infinite path b in any infinite binary tree . Based on this principle one can formulate subsystems of higher-order arithmetic which allow to carry out very substantial parts of classical mathematics but are Π 2 0 -conservative over primitive recursive arithmetic PRA . In Kohlenbach 1239–1273) we established such conservation results relative to finite type extensions PRA ω of PRA . In this setting one can consider also a (...) version UWKL of WKL which asserts the existence of a functional Φ which selects uniformly in a given infinite binary tree f an infinite path Φf of that tree. This uniform version of WKL is of interest in the context of explicit mathematics as developed by S. Feferman. The elimination process in Kohlenbach [10] actually can be used to eliminate even this uniform weak König's lemma provided that PRA ω only has a quantifier-free rule of extensionality QF-ER instead of the full axioms of extensionality for all finite types. In this paper we show that in the presence of , UWKL is much stronger than WKL: whereas WKL remains to be Π 2 0 -conservative over PRA, PRA ω ++ UWKL contains full Peano arithmetic PA. We also investigate the proof–theoretic as well as the computational strength of UWKL relative to the intuitionistic variant of PRA ω both with and without the Markov principle. (shrink)
